Chupar

Chupar is a village located in Nabagram subdivision of Murshidabad district in West Bengal, India. Berhampore and Nabagram are the district & sub-district headquarters of Chupar village respectively. As per 2009 stats, Hajbibidanga is the gram panchayat of Chupar village.

About Chupar

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Chupar is 314959. The village spans a total geographical area of 176.08 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 742181. Berhampore is nearest town to Chupar village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 10km away.

Population of Chupar

Below is a concise population overview of Chupar as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 5,367 2,792 2,575
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 818 422 396
Scheduled Castes (SC) 141 81 60
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 2 1 1
Literate Population 2,985 1,670 1,315
Illiterate Population 2,382 1,122 1,260

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Chupar village:

  • The total population of Chupar village is around 5,367, including approximately 2,792 males and 2,575 females, with a sex ratio of 922 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 818 children aged 0–6 years in Chupar village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Chupar village has 141 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C) and 2 residents from the Scheduled Tribes (ST).
  • The literacy rate of Chupar village is about 55.62%, with male literacy at 59.81% and female literacy at 51.07%.
  • There are around 1,189 households in Chupar village.

Connectivity of Chupar

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Chupar. As per the 2011 stats, Chupar had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Private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
